Why yard waste fills a container faster than expected

Branches and brush are mostly empty space once they’re piled — a container can look full of yard debris while actually holding a modest amount of material by weight. That works in your favor on weight limits, but it means volume, not weight, is usually the number that decides the size for a yard-waste job, which is the opposite of a concrete or shingle load.

What's excluded from a yard-waste load

Dirt and sod in large quantities weigh far more than branches and brush of the same volume, so a big landscaping job that includes significant excavation may need separate handling — see our concrete and heavy debris page for that situation. Treated or painted lumber from an old fence or deck also needs to be called out separately rather than mixed into a green-waste load.

Why do branches and brush fill a container so much faster than other debris?

Branches and brush are bulky relative to their weight — they take up real volume without adding much to the weight allowance, so a yard-waste container is usually sized by volume rather than weight, the opposite of a concrete or shingle load.

Can you deliver quickly after a storm?

We prioritize storm cleanup and offer same-day and rush delivery when we can, though demand spikes fast right after severe weather across the whole area. Calling as soon as you know cleanup is coming helps.

Can dirt or sod go in with the branches and brush?

A limited amount is fine, but a large quantity of dirt or sod weighs far more than the same volume of brush and may need to be handled as a heavy-debris load instead — mention it when you call.

What size container do I need for a full yard cleanup?

Most full property cleanups run on a 20 yard. A smaller trim-and-clear job can often use a 15, and major storm damage or a large landscaping overhaul may need a 30. Tell us the scope and we’ll size it right.

Can old fence or deck lumber go in with yard debris?

Untreated wood generally can, but treated or painted lumber needs to be called out separately rather than mixed into a green-waste load — ask us about your specific material.

Do I need a Belleville permit for a yard-waste dumpster?

Yes, the same registration rule applies — Belleville requires registering placement through the Building Department even on a private driveway, with a 30-day limit.
